rds-proxy-tls-encryption

Checks if Amazon RDS proxies enforce TLS for all connections. The rule is NON_COMPLIANT if an Amazon RDS proxy does not have TLS enforced for all connections.

Identifier: RDS_PROXY_TLS_ENCRYPTION

Resource Types: AWS::RDS::DBProxy

Trigger type: Periodic

Amazon Web Services Region: All supported Amazon regions except Asia Pacific (New Zealand), Asia Pacific (Thailand), Asia Pacific (Malaysia), Amazon GovCloud (US-East), Amazon GovCloud (US-West), Mexico (Central), Asia Pacific (Taipei) Region

Parameters:

None
